New Delhi - India’s digital economy is growing at 2.8 percent per annum and is expected to reach $1 trillion by 2027-28, minister of state for electronics and IT Rajeev Chandrasekhar said at an outreach programme. The minister further said the value of the IndiaAI mission will be doubled to Rs 20,000 crore from Rs 10,000 crore.

The government earlier expected India to reach the $1 trillion-mark by 2026-27 but the target has been moved by a year due to various reasons, including the Covid-19 pandemic, he said.
